What are Mini Trifles?

Mini Trifles are simple trifles but served in small glasses, made with layers of sweet and creamy textures like any regular trifles. With a crunchy layer of crushed graham crackers, topped with a creamy mixture of whipped cream and flavors (I used caramel for this recipe). Finished with mini chocolate chips on top, or any favorite toppings you like, they’re simple to prepare, requiring minimal cooking and time, making them an enjoyable dessert option for the weekends.

Ingredients

  • 1 cup caramel sauce
  • 2 cups heavy cream
  • 1/2 cup powdered sugar
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1 cup crushed graham crackers
  • 1/2 cup mini chocolate chips

How to Make Mini Trifles?

Step 1:

Whip the cream in a bowl with a mixer until it gets thick. Add powdered sugar and vanilla, and keep mixing.

Step 2:

Put crushed graham crackers in the bottom of four glasses (You can add more if you want, I made the recipe for both my kids and my husband and me of course, So four glasses is enough for us). Add the whipped cream on top of the crackers.

Step 3:

Sprinkle mini chocolate chips on the whipped cream. Or add some chocolate chunks as I did for this recipe, Drizzle some caramel sauce if you want.

Step 4:

Put the glasses in the fridge for 2 hours so the cream is set. Enjoy.

Helpful Tips!

  • For fluffy whipped cream, keep the cream and mixing bowl cold.
  • Try to Crush graham crackers into fine pieces for a better texture in your trifle.
  • Always Chill ingredients like caramel sauce before using them.
  • When chilling, don’t forget to cover the glasses with plastic wrap to avoid the smell of the fridge.

FAQ

Can I use store-bought caramel sauce?

Yes, store-bought caramel sauce works perfectly as well.

How long should I chill the trifles?

Chill for at least 2 hours to allow the cream to set.

Can I make these trifles dairy-free?

Yes, use coconut cream instead.

What can I use instead of graham crackers?

Sometimes I use Crushed cookies.

How can I make the cream sweeter?

Add more powdered sugar according to what you like.

Can I freeze the trifles?

It’s best to avoid freezing trifles as the cream may change texture. Instead, try to Store them in the refrigerator.

Can I add fruit to the trifles?

Yes, You can layer in some fresh fruit like berries or bananas.
